The HTAC 911-to-988 Diversion: Agency Implementation Toolkit is designed for law enforcement agencies and emergency communications centers that are ready to move beyond planning and begin building the operational foundation of an agency-specific diversion program.

Successful implementation requires much more than deciding which calls may be appropriate for transfer to 988. Agencies must translate executive decisions into policies, procedures, workflows, partnerships, technology requirements, training plans, documentation standards, quality-assurance processes, and measurable implementation objectives.

The Agency Implementation Toolkit provides the practical worksheets, checklists, planning frameworks, and implementation tools needed to organize those decisions and move your agency from PLAN to BUILD.

Rather than prescribing a universal diversion protocol, the toolkit helps your organization develop a program around its own policies, operational requirements, legal guidance, staffing, technology, available resources, and local 988/crisis-system capabilities.

Built for Agency-Specific Implementation

Your agency defines the protocol. The toolkit helps you build the framework.

There is no single 911-to-988 diversion model appropriate for every jurisdiction.

The HTAC Agency Implementation Toolkit does not establish universal eligibility criteria, exclusion criteria, emergency-response thresholds, or transfer protocols. Instead, it provides a structured framework that allows agencies to develop and document those decisions based on their own legal guidance, policies, operations, resources, technology, and local crisis-response system.

The purchasing agency retains responsibility for reviewing and approving its final policies, procedures, protocols, training standards, and operational decisions.
